 --WEEKLY SCHEDULE
1. Week  Dual number systems and dual number rings
2. Week  Matrix representations of dual numbers and dual vector spaces
3. Week  D-module, inner product and norm on D-module
4. Week  E. Study mappings and dual angle
5. Week  Exterior product, mixed product on D-module
6. Week  . Dual isometries on D-module
7. Week  . Taylor series of dual valuable functions
8. Week  . Mid-term exam, Taylor series of dual valuable functions
9. Week  Real quaternion algebra
10. Week  Matrix representation of real quaternions
11. Week  . Symplectic geometry
12. Week  . Dual quaternion
13. Week  Line quaternion
14. Week  . Quaternion operators, rotation and translation operators
